Tyylitaso is a design concept used in Finnish design discourse to describe the degree to which a product, experience, or work adheres to a specified stylistic framework. The term combines "tyyli" (style) and "taso" (level) and is used across fashion, graphic design, interior design, and product design to assess coherence and visual language.
